Searches for body-based form on the basis of modern wood technology

Research on the sustainability of timber and timber construction, preparing prototypes, testing in small structures. The experimental design and technology project Varjualune/Shelter form a part of the instruction of first-year students of architecture and urban design – experiments with space, form and material on the scale of human body. Link
